    Flavorwise : You’re the ultimate peacekeeper. Kind of a Superman feeling, you have the ability to overcome anything big bad and angry dudes throw at you and, as such, you have the integrity to use your powers to de-escalate any situations. First time a character might be able to make peace (instead of the usual “destroy evil until it looks peaceful enough”) rest upon the lands of D&D.
    Fun Fact : Henry Cavill has played Superman in The Man of Steel and Sherlock Holmes in Enola Holmes. So the crossover exists !

    Powerwise : You find a suspect, use your boosted taunt DCs (Test of Mettle & Goad) to make him attack you, which constitutes a crime, then you appease him with Calm Emotions, Enthrall, Pacifying Touch, … and arrest him.
    All of this is described in The De-Escalation Technique (see Combo Section below).
    Once that is done you have a legitimate reason to interrogate him and the means to make him talk : your social skills and bonuses are insanely packed (Nymph’s Kiss, WD class features, the Vows bonuses, skill synergies) so if we assume you can take 20 on your interrogation, you’ll know what you need to know.

    Skillwise : The SI and Urban Ranger are 6+Int, AoP is 4+Int leaving only the Knight 2+Int being a stain here. You’re human (+23 pts), you get Nymph’s kiss at 1st level (+20 pts), you get 14 Int (16 at 15th and 18 at 19th) for a total of 209 points spent.
    Boosts from Vows (+6 to Diplomacy), Nymph’s Kiss +2 to Cha related checks mixed with this juicy skill list makes you quite the diplomancer.
    The Investigation Technique (Combo Section also) is also a good display of how this build makes it really hard to escape you.

    Vows & codes :
    So looking at the SI and AV’s first comment that this class wasn’t allowed to do what it should be able to, it reminded me of a couple of classes with similar problems namely Knight and Apostle of Peace. If you’re going to be your own worst enemy, might as well do it to the fullest right ?
    This build includes 3 severely binding vows and 2 different and strict Codes of Conduct and still manages to do crazy things.
    Fyi, there is another version of this possible where you get into Prestige Paladin (another Oath) and then Gray Guard to get Sacrament of Trust but more about it in the Discussion Section.

    Sweet Spot
    Level 12 : Karmic Strike is a very important part for the De-escalation Technique (see Combo Section). You can also finally strike without the -4 penalty for non-lethal damage which is basically a +4 to-hit. You get your second ability enhancement, decent AC and Nemesis which makes you a hunting hound for the Moriart Sect.
    Level 15 gets Robilar’s Gambit which is the 3rd step of the De-escalation Technique, so second Sweet Spot definitely.

    Spoiler: The De-escalation Technique
    Show

    Test of Mettle + the good ol’ “duck n cover” + VoPeace aura
    You taunt them (100ft radius Test of Mettle and if that fails Goad as a backup),
    You hide (using the Bluff skill to create a diversion then get total cover),
    They mad
    Can’t range attack you (no LoS), so all they have left to do is to cast AoE spells blindly to where you might be or come and rough you up in person… and walk into the VoPeace Aura (high Cha & DC +4 thanks to Vow of Non-violence), leaving their hate and rage at the door.
    Another fun trick is having them at the edge of your VoP Aura and using twice your movement to force them in and out of the aura as much as possible, triggering a new save everytime

    If that fails
    Pacifying Touch + Karmic Strike + Hold the Line
    They managed to be next to you and still angry they will try to hit you. You lowered your AC by 4 so they should manage and, just before they do, you get a “There There” attempt on them. You have a full BaB from Urban Ranger & Knight and Intuitive Strike with a nice Wisdom so a melee touch attack should be right up your alley. If you hit, they chill out instantly, no SR, no save, meaning if you touch them, they’re de-escalated and ready for interrogation.
    An attack of opportunity "interrupts" the normal flow of actions in the round. If an attack of opportunity is provoked, immediately resolve the attack of opportunity, then continue
    .
    If you fail, they hit you and might break their weapon against your VoPeace Aura which should take them down a notch. Anyway, if they insist, you can try to AoO again “Dex” times (drinking potions of Cat’s Grace is both nice and allowed).
    Late game, if they charge you, let’em. First save for getting into the Aura, then you get one AoO when they get in melee range and then one when they attack.

    If that fails
    Robilar’s Gambit + Pacifying Touch + Calm Emotions
    So you’re in melee with people that saved against the peace aura’s high DC and either failed to hit you or you did.
    All you have to do is move your speed among them, hell you can even cast non-defensively (Calm Emotions or Enthrall DCs are boosted by VoNon-violence) triggering AoOs, and try and pacify them again.

    If that fails
    Roll another character sheet man, the dice Gods have spoken.


    Spoiler: The Investigation Technique
    Show

    1) Go fish
    You aren’t completely omniscient so you must set out to find what’s been going on in the city.
    Enter the Knowledge (local) (+WD level from Obsessive Specialty and, late game, Instant Knowledge) and Gather Information (+2 synergy from Knowledge (local), +2 Nymph’s Kiss, +2 Skill Synergy (Diplomacy - Gather Information))

    2) Social shenanigans
    i) Okay so before you even start interrogating people, you’re pretty much everyone’s BFF. Diplomacy is maxed, you get the 3 synergy bonuses from Bluff, Knowledge (Nobility) and Sense Motive, the respective +2 (perfection) and +4 (exalted) from Sacred Vow & VoPeace, the Skill Synergy (Diplomacy - Gather Information) and the +2 from Nymph’s Kiss (that’s +16).
    ii) Bluff and Sense Motive comes in a bit later, with the experience of the job, but helps you adapt to situations, getting innuendos across for instance or see through falsehood before you can flat out Discern Lies.
    The Favored Enemy organization brings an appreciated +2 Bluff, Sense Motive, Listen, Spot checks against members of the Moriart Sect that stacks with the City Watch Training’s.
    iii) Intimidate as last resort in case your diplomatic intercessions previously failed (+2 from Bluff and Nymph’s Kiss).

    3) Once a relationship is established, you have options.
    i) Use your Urban Tracking to find the witnesses of the deed and question them so as to have your Profile and Deductive Augury running to pinpoint a suspect.
    ii) Use Urban Tracking to find said person of interest directly or, if pressed by time, Locate Creature or the Helping Hand spell should do the trick.
    iii) Find out where the person of interest lives and get a warrant (given the medieval fantasy of D&D, your standing as a lawman is probably enough but you never know) to investigate the place with your awesome Search, Detect Secret Doors, Locate Object and Forensics.

    4) The end
    You’ve found your suspect.
    First, drown him in your social skills until he admits willingly to have commited the wrongful deed.
    If by some sort of miracle he resists you, Test of Mettle his a** and use the De-escalation Technique (see above).
    Now, attacking an officer of the law is a serious crime that will get you taken into custody for further questioning.
    Find anyone friendly (or even indifferent), talk to them for a full-minute (ranks+18 Diplomacy if they are Good aligned).
    Now that they’re helpful, you can conduct a Cooperative Interrogation, to make your prisoner spill the beans on the matter you’re looking into. Of course Discern Lies helps you a ton in these situations and even if you’re out, Sense Motive can take over.
    So you have arrested a dangerous criminal mastermind/demon, the streets are safer thanks to you, bask in your glory.

    The watch detective has two main defining features. First, he deals nonlethal damage, and second, he knows exactly where to look for criminals.
    Spoiler: I know who did this, how they did it, and where they’ll be next monday
    Show

    Between his numerous skills, Profile, Deductive Augury and Locate Things, there is a high chance he will know exactly who he is after and what the criminal in question is capable of. This is why one of the point of this build is its versatility. Given 24 hours, Brother Hacatfael can change the most fundamental parts of his build to adapt to whatever is in front of him. He is capable of picking abilities from five different kinds of magic : Incarnum, divine, Vestiges, weapon properties and martial arts. If these abilities would be quite weak by themselves, they can become much stronger if they are combined and perfectly adapted to the opponent.

    Spoiler: I don’t care if he’s a Sith Lord, he must stand trial
    Show

    But what distinguishes the good detective from the ruthless wizard is that the detective doesn’t want to kill his opponent, and that he can beat the criminal unconscious without ever risking that they die before their trial. And that is accomplished by being capable of dealing relatively small amount of nonlethal damage a lot of times, while adding bonuses each time, until the criminal falls unconscious from a thousand paper cuts, or more accurately a thousand flicks of a claw. For that, the Justiciar prestige class is quite good (if maybe a bit repetitive of the Watch Detective class features), with his capacity to increase the damage dealing ability of the detective, but also deal Strength damage to reduce the offensive capabilities of big beatsticks, who are often the ones with the highest DR (a pain for a multiattack build).

    Spoiler: Search like a hawk, strike like a snake
    Show

    All of that is accomplished by gaining knowledge of the opponent and acting while being unseen himself, which is where the numerous skills come into play, with a lot going into Spot, Hide, Listen, and Move Silently. This is also complemented by the link of Hecatfael with nature, and his knowledge of animals, notably his pet bat, who can help him both as witnesses with speak with animals, to scout from far away, and to gain a cheesy flanking in combat.


    The overall result would probably be more adapted for an NPC or a DMPC, who has more downtime than a regular adventurous party, or in an investigation-centered campaign, but should still be playable even without relying too much on his adaptability.

    Spoiler: Level Breakdown
    Show

    ECL 5: Especially at low level at will invisibility is really powerful and should enable Varash to scout enemy positions and report back to the rest of the party. Eagle totem barbarian and to a lesser extent favored enemy add a bonus to the core skills of Varash and watch detective of search and spot (and listen for FE). Track and survival are kind of weird for a class that seems to revolve around cities but in reality watch detective is more about a general theme of investigator which is not at all limited to cities. Although he lacks the trap finding class feature to find magical traps, Varash very reliably should detect all mundane traps. At ECL 5 Varash rolls 1d20+14 on Search checks, 1d20+12 (+14 vs favored enemies) on Spot checks and 1d20 + 9 (+11 vs favored enemies) on Listen checks. The investigate feat expands the use of search to find clues. Varash is able to track enemies (1d20+8 or 1d20+10 vs favored enemies) and dabbles in gather information and sense motive. The various knowledge skills are meant to be rasied to 5 ranks to add a bonus in finding clues via the Investiagte feat. In combat Varash wears light or medium armor and uses an oversized longbow (or composite longbow with no strength rating). He uses Rapid Shot if possible and carries some blunt arrows to deal nonlethal damage as it is an effective method of capturing criminals. Varash avoids melee whenever possible using invisibility at will (1 minute duration) and dimension hop to (re)position himself. If forced into melee, rage 1/day together with an oversized weapon may be sufficient to deal with weaker enemies. Rage may also help with overcoming problematic fortitude saves. Demoralizing an opponent is another option if forced into melee since powerful build should help raising your chances of success (1d20+8+size modifier). Autohypnosis is not only a prerequisite for soulbow but also a great way to reliably memorize a lot of text or numbers.

    ECL 10: After one more stepstone level of Soulknife, at ECL 7 the Wisdom SAD-ness for ranged attacks is finally accomplished. Zen archery and mind arrows work very well on a character that relies on high wisdom scores which Varash needs for spot, listen, survival and sense motive checks. This also allows Varash to start using shields, as mind arrows don’t need hands. At least in the groups I played shields as loot often ended up being sold because noone wanted them. At ECL 8 city watch training is a very welcome boost to absolute core skills of Varash. Obsessive specialty (Knowledge arcana) frees up ranks for other Knowledge skills which all compliment the Investigate as soon as Varash has 5 ranks in them. Profile’s DC is quite low, which is why gather information didn’t get more ranks early in my build. Varash may be my first character that actually intends to use Combat Expertise the way it is written. When cornered in melee +5 AC together with a shield, decent (medium) armor and +2 Dexterity might be enough to stall until friends come to the rescue. If noone comes, there ist still the option of using rage. Dimension hop and invisibility at will should still cover ositioning in combat. Cooperative interrogation is a little weird but can work well with a character focused on feinting in combat and any character with bluff outside of combat. Superior disarming on the other hand is a very nice untyped bonus. Together with the feat ranged disarm Varash can very reliably disarm enemies at a distance. At ECL 10 his ranged disarm roll is 1d20+14+size modifier (BAB+ wisdom + weapon focus (mind blade) + superior disarming + size). While I don’t think it will happen too often, readying a ranged disarm action vs a charging enemy that relies on a weapon seems really fun.

    ECL 15: Deductive augury is a great class feature. A 74-80% chance of coaxing information out of the DM even only once per day is something I rate really high. Skill synergy chosen for Spot and Search is of course another great boost to the already very high checks. No Subdual penalty should work with mind arrows as I don’t see anything in the rules that forbids using mind arrows in a nonlethal way. Sense secret doors is something we grab along the way. Locate object is an SLA and therefor benefits from magical knack gained by primordial giant. Dream Scion ist the first step of the dreamtouch feat line. Varash can prebuff himself for combat or skill checks entering the dreamtouched state. At ECL 14 mind arrows can be enchanted with the merciful weapon property. In conjunction with Improved Subdual this means that mind arrows now add Intelligence and Wisdom bonus on damage which is doubly nice with Dream Scion. This means that a single mind arrow now deals 1d8+ 1d6 + Wisdom bonus + Intelligence bonus (possibly another +3 for point blank shot and favored enemy) nonlethal damage.

    ECL 20: Forensics is automatically a success unless a 1 is rolled. Discern lies and locate creature gain the same bonus as locate object. I have literally nothing good to say about instant knowledge other than the real capstone of watch detective to me is deductive augury thrice a day. Varash can try and use a successful instant knowledge (which gets alittle more likely in dreamtouched state) in conjunction with Dream of Perception for a +20 bonus on a knowledge skill check. The last two levels of soulbow enhance mind arrows further, add a bonus feat and allow for use of mind arrows in melee which is a really big help to Varash. Dream of strength and dream of perception round out the build in adding a small portion of damage (+1 insight bonus), a Fortitude save boost (and an emergency +5 boost) and a +1 insight bonus on skill checks as well as will saves. The option of adding +10 to any skill check and ending the dreamtouched state seems very useful for surely not missing any clues using the investigate feat. The added ranks in autohypnosis are meant to help tolerate poisons, resist dying and use the willpower option of autohypnosis.

    Skill Progression Explanation
    Sibyll’s most important skills are those related to her interrogations and intelligence gathering, in particular sense motive but also including bluff, diplomacy, gather information and search. Her secondary skills include her knowledge skills and survival. Survival is very important to Sibyll once she gains the ability to astrally track her targets, though in early levels she can mostly get by with synergy bonuses and her Wisdom. For her knowledge skills, early on she focuses on local knowledge, but as her power of prophecy grows stronger, she switches to planar knowledge as her primary knowledge skill. This also aids her in the reading of dreams.

    In general Sibyll focuses her skills first on always keeping bluff, diplomacy, gather information, search and sense motive. Her second priority is to meet all skill requirements, including stealth skills for ebon saint and spellcraft for astral tracking. Once those objectives are met, Sibyll uses any spare skill points to “catch up” on any secondary skills that fell behind while Sibyll was focusing on meeting prerequisites.

    Levels 1 - 5
    Psychic Rogue 5

    In these early days, Sibyll functions as your typical roguish character: namely, she stays out of the way and tries not to die, making opportunistic sneak attacks as necessary. Her psychic abilities aid considerably in this, with entangling ectoplasm being a great way to keep foes at bay. Out of combat, however, is where she shines. Her skills are exceptional, covering the social and investigative skills. These are further buoyed by her powers: Sibyll benefits from conceal thoughts for a +10 bonus on bluff checks for an hour/level and detect hostile intent, which not only provides her with an effective alternate sense and prevents her from being caught surprised or flat-footed but also allows her to make sense motive checks as a free action against anyone within 30’. Note that detect hostile intent specifically penetrates barriers, meaning she can use it to scan other rooms or areas for people with hostile intent and use sense motive to assess the issue.

    And speaking of her investigative skills, thanks to the Investigate feat she can do far more than look for traps with her search skill. She can use search to “locate clues, discern patterns, analyze evidence, and draw conclusions about what occurred in a specific area.”

    Levels 6 - 10
    Psychic Rogue 5/Watch Detective 4/Ebon Saint 1

    At level 6, Sibyll takes her first level in watch detective and picks up Master Manipulator. This feat is perhaps the single best way to wrangle confessions out of targets: if she catches someone in a lie, she can trick them into inadvertently revealing their lie and the reason behind it. With watch detective further boosting her sense motive checks (among other things) and buffs like conceal thoughts and detect hostile intent, she should easily be able to force her suspects into revealing key information and confessing if necessary.

    Combat Expertise comes online as a free feat, which in turn qualifies her for Improved Feint - not the most exciting combat feat, but Sibyll has a great bluff check and sneak attack, and Improved Feint qualifies her for ebon saint. This will become quite important to her investigations in short order. Deductive augury and profile, meanwhile, are added to her psychic crime-solving repertoire.

    Levels 11 - 15 (Sweet Spot)
    Psychic Rogue 5/Watch Detective 5/Ebon Saint 3/Heir of Siberys 2

    A lot happens in these levels. In particular, ebon saint gives her the tool she most needs to interrogate her foes: the ability to read minds outright. Thought theft is decent, giving her read thoughts, but there are a lot of limitations on it, such as the fact that a Will save negates it or the difficulty in turning surface thoughts into evidence. Mind interrogation, on the other hand, is absolutely incredible. On a dire strike she can visualize a question in her head and, if the suspect knows the answer, Sibyll immediately knows it as well - with no saving throw or ability to bluff it away! Magical evidence isn’t admissible, of course, but with Master Manipulator (now further boosted by Inquisitor for a whopping +10 bonus to her already impressive sense motive checks) she can easily use that psychic knowledge to garner a confession. With her ability to make nonlethal strikes, she doesn’t need to actively injure her foes for these dire strikes.

    And while mind interrogation allows her to wrest secrets out of the living that she can then use to force in confessions via Master Manipulator, object reading comes online and gives her a plethora of details about the physical objects around her. After finding a clue via Investigate, she can then use object reading to determine things like race, gender, age, alignment and details about the owner of these clues, which in turn can help point her in the direction of new targets to investigate.

    Meanwhile, her Siberys mark fully manifests, giving her the Siberys mark of passage for a daily CL 15 greater teleport. This comes online at the same time that she picks up Astral Tracking (Heir of Siberys grants unrestricted bonus feats in lieu of advancing a caster level for non-casters). Astral Tracking is a unique little feat from Dragon Compendium that says that if you track someone to a place where they used teleportation magic to leave, you can make a DC 30 survival check to find out where they went and use your own teleportation magic to follow them. With greater teleport and Astral Tracking, Sibyll should be able to follow her suspects to the ends of the earth. And if they travel beyond the material plane, well, she IS a respected Siberys member of House Orien and has the mechanical ability to call in favors, making a plane shift or astral caravan easily within reach.

    Her planar knowledge moves beyond just the ability to track targets across the planes, though. In these levels she also learns to interpret prophetic dreams. Dreamtelling requires a knowledge (the planes) check to study the prophetic symbolism of a dream (whether her own or another’s). If she exceeds the DC by 10, she receives the benefit of a divination spell, and if she exceeds it by 20 she receives the benefits of a commune spell. These prophetic visions assist her greatly in finding and punishing wrongdoing.

    Levels 16 - 20
    Psychic Rogue 5/Watch Detective 10/Ebon Saint 3/Heir of Siberys 2

    Finishing out watch detective provides Sibyll with a number of powerful divinations to add to her repertoire, including locate object, discern lies and locate creature. She also adds on the forensics ability to garner even more information than Investigate provides. As a capstone she receives the powerful instant knowledge ability, giving her the potential to increase her knowledge (the planes) roll by 10. This stacks with obsessive specialty, allowing for as much as a +20 bonus on her knowledge (the planes) checks, which she can in turn use to generate communes via the reading of dreams.

    Spoiler: Chef’s notes
    Show

    On reading watch detective, my first thought was that many of the class’s abilities could easily be refluffed as the mystical powers of a seer or fortune teller, rather than those of a master detective. That idea set me off, and I decided to build around it. I wanted to build a seer who used her visions and powers to unravel a crime, and then use Master Manipulator’s trap of words to force suspects into inadvertently confessing.

    Regarding the watch detective’s abilities:
    • Entry requirements: The skills are all a breeze for Sibyll d’Orien, since she is already keeping search at maximum for Investigate, and Track is required for Astral Tracking, which she uses extensively after heir of Siberys comes online (see her levels 11-15 description).
    • City watch training: A flat bonus to several skills is quite important, in particular search (which drives Sibyll’s Investigate feat) and sense motive (arguably the most important skill to this build).
    • Expertise: While Sibyll prefers to avoid combat altogether whenever possible, anything to boost her defenses will never go amiss. More importantly, however, Combat Expertise is one of the pre-reqs for ebon saint, and watch detective gives it to her for free.
    • Obsessive specialty: As a seer, Sibyll must learn all she can of dreams, and can eventually read dreams via Dreamtelling for a free divination or commune. These are incredibly strong divinations, but they require high knowledge (the planes) checks to reliably access them. Getting what eventually becomes a +10 bonus to these checks is huge.
    • Profile: The first of the abilities that made me think of this class as some sort of seer rather than a detective. She can get an image of the perpetrator of a crime from someone who has never actually seen the perpetrator? That’s amazing! And it’s definitely easy to fluff as a psychic ability, despite its (Ex) tag.
    • Cooperative investigation: Working with the city watch, Sibyll can make good use of her high bluff checks to play good cop, and in doing so make the bad cop all the more intimidating.
    • Superior disarming: Superior disarming is an ability that exists and is something that Sibyll can theoretically do if she ever feels like wasting a turn.
    • Deductive augury: The second ability that made me think “hey, this would be a really cool seer.” Sure, it’s meant to be fluffed as a Sherlock-style logical leap, but it works even better as an actual augury. (Plus it’s useful as heck.)
    • Skill synergy: I mentioned that sense motive was probably her most important skill, right? Between this, city watch training and Inquisitor, Sibyll can put out ridiculously high sense motive checks, which are vital for Master Manipulator’s trap of words. (Boosting gather info is nice too, of course.)
    • No subdual penalty: Ebon saint’s abilities require you to study and then strike your target. Sibyll isn’t particularly interested in starting any fights, but abilities like mind interrogation are absolutely incredible (seriously, no save, no way to guard, just a full answer to a question). This allows her to nonlethally tap her target to get the full benefit.
    • Sense secret doors: “I’m getting a vision - there’s something here!” (Cue dramatically pulling aside the throw rug to reveal a trapdoor.)
    • Locate object: Oh come on, now we’re not even trying to pretend these abilities are anything but mystical anymore.
    • Improved subdual: Well, she doesn’t love combat, but she DOES have a really high Intelligence score, so adding Int to damage is nice.
    • Forensics: “Violence leaves an… impression on the body and the soul. My dreaming eye can read those impressions like a map.” With search already maximized for Investigate this DC is trivial, allowing Sibyll to “read the psychic impressions” of dead bodies to determine the cause of death.
    • Discern lies: Yet another tool to help catch her targets in any lies.
    • Locate creature: Even better than locate object! Between this, Track and Astral Tracking, you cannot escape Sibyll d’Orien.
    • Instant knowledge: Again, this is easy to fluff as a flash of mystic insight rather than a Sherlock-style deduction, and it also combines nicely with obsessive specialty to make the Dreamtelling DCs a breeze.
